日本综合一区二区|亚洲中文天堂综合|日韩欧美自拍一区|男女精品天堂一区|欧美自拍第6页亚洲成人精品一区|亚洲黄色天堂一区二区成人|超碰91偷拍第一页|日韩av夜夜嗨中文字幕|久久蜜综合视频官网|精美人妻一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
創(chuàng)新互聯(lián)數(shù)據(jù)庫教程:Linux安裝配置MySQL詳細(xì)步驟

MySQL 推薦使用 RPM 包進(jìn)行 Linux 平臺(tái)下的安裝,因?yàn)?RPM 包的安裝和卸載都很方便,通過簡單的命令就可以實(shí)現(xiàn)。本節(jié)主要介紹 Linux 下如何使用 RPM 包安裝和配置 MySQL。

創(chuàng)新新互聯(lián),憑借十載的成都網(wǎng)站建設(shè)、成都做網(wǎng)站經(jīng)驗(yàn),本著真心·誠心服務(wù)的企業(yè)理念服務(wù)于成都中小企業(yè)設(shè)計(jì)網(wǎng)站有上1000家案例。做網(wǎng)站建設(shè),選創(chuàng)新互聯(lián)公司。

本節(jié)的安裝環(huán)境為 CentOS 6.5,選用 el6 的安裝包。讀者應(yīng)根據(jù)自己的系統(tǒng)來選擇相對應(yīng)的安裝包,例如:CentOS 7 應(yīng)該選用 el7 安裝包。如果安裝包對應(yīng)的系統(tǒng)版本不正確,安裝時(shí)會(huì)出現(xiàn)有關(guān) glibc 的依賴錯(cuò)誤。

下面通過 RPM 包進(jìn)行安裝,具體操作步驟如下:

步驟 1):進(jìn)入官方下載頁面( http://dev.mysql.com/downloads/mysql)選擇要下載的包(可直接點(diǎn)擊下方鏈接進(jìn)行下載)。

  • mysql-community-common-5.7.29-1.el6.x86_64.rpm
  • mysql-community-libs-5.7.29-1.el6.x86_64.rpm
  • mysql-community-client-5.7.29-1.el6.x86_64.rpm
  • mysql-community-server-5.7.29-1.el6.x86_64.rpm

步驟 2):下載完成后,切換到 root 用戶。按照依賴關(guān)系依次安裝 rpm 包,依賴關(guān)系依次為 common→libs→client→server。使用命令
rpm -ivh {-file-name}進(jìn)行安裝操作。

rpm -ivh mysql-community-common-5.7.29-1.el6.x86_64.rpm
rpm -ivh mysql-community-libs-5.7.29-1.el6.x86_64.rpm
rpm -ivh mysql-community-client-5.7.29-1.el6.x86_64.rpm
rpm -ivh mysql-community-server-5.7.29-1.el6.x86_64.rpm

ivh 中,i-install 參數(shù)表示安裝后面的一個(gè)或多個(gè) RPM 軟件包;v-verbose 參數(shù)表示安裝過程中顯示詳細(xì)的信息;h-hash 參數(shù)表示使用“#”來顯示安裝進(jìn)度。

在 Linux 操作系統(tǒng)下安裝 MySQL 時(shí),一定要注意權(quán)限問題。安裝 RPM 軟件包時(shí),需要使用 root 權(quán)限,否則會(huì)提示權(quán)限不夠。且安裝完成后,也需要使用 root 權(quán)限啟動(dòng)和關(guān)閉 MySQL 服務(wù)。

步驟 3):通過以下命令可以啟動(dòng) MySQL 數(shù)據(jù)庫,但是必須使用 root 權(quán)限。

service mysql start

提示:從 MySQL 5.0 開始,MySQL 的服務(wù)名改為 mysql,而不是 4.* 的 mysqld。

MySQL 服務(wù)的操作命令是:

service mysql start | stop | restart | status

以上幾個(gè)參數(shù)的意義如下:

  • start:啟動(dòng) MySQL 服務(wù)
  • stop:停止 MySQL 服務(wù)
  • restart:重啟 MySQL 服務(wù)
  • status:查看 MySQL 服務(wù)狀態(tài)

步驟 4):服務(wù)啟動(dòng)后,查找 root 初始隨機(jī)密碼(如果沒有初始密碼,直接輸入用戶名 root 登錄即可)

cat /var/log/mysqld.log | grep 'temporary password is generated'

步驟 5):安裝成功后,使用以下命令登錄 MySQL。

mysql -uroot -p

如果看到以下歡迎信息,說明登錄成功,接下來就可以對 MySQL 數(shù)據(jù)庫進(jìn)行操作了。

[root@localhost ~]# mysql -uroot -p
Enter password: ****
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 1
Server version: 5.7.29 MySQL Community Server (GPL)

Copyright (c) 2000, 2020,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

以上說明性語句介紹如下:

  • Commands end with; or\g:說明 mysql 命令行下的命令是以分號(hào)(;)或“\g”來結(jié)束的,遇到這個(gè)結(jié)束符就開始執(zhí)行命令。
  • Your MySQL connection id is 1:id 表示 MySQL 數(shù)據(jù)庫的連接次數(shù),這里為 1,說明是首次登錄。
  • Server version: 5. 7.29-log MySQL Community Server(GPL):Server version 后面說明數(shù)據(jù)庫的版本,這個(gè)版本為 5.7.29。Community 表示該版本是社區(qū)版。
  • Type 'help;' or '\h' for help:表示輸入”help;“或者”\h“可以看到幫助信息。
  • Type '\c' to clear the current input statement:表示遇到”\c“就清除前面的命令。

提示:當(dāng)窗口中出現(xiàn)如上圖所示的說明信息,命令提示符變?yōu)椤癿ysql>”時(shí),表明已經(jīng)成功登錄 MySQL 服務(wù)器,可以開始對數(shù)據(jù)庫進(jìn)行操作了。  

步驟 6):可使用以下命令修改密碼

set password='testroot';

使用 RPM 包安裝時(shí),系統(tǒng)不會(huì)提示各種文件安裝在哪個(gè)文件夾下。下面介紹每個(gè)主要的文件在什么目錄下,MySQL 服務(wù)器目錄以及子目錄如下表所示:

Linux平臺(tái)MySQL的安裝目錄

文件夾 文件夾內(nèi)容
/usr/bin 客戶端和腳本(mysqladmin、mysqldump 等命令)
/usr/sbin mysqld 服務(wù)器
/var/lib/mysql 日志文件、socket 文件和數(shù)據(jù)庫
/usr/share/info 信息格式的手冊
/usr/share/man UNIX 幫助頁
/usr/include/mysql 頭文件
/usr/lib/mysql
/usr/share/mysql 錯(cuò)誤消息、字符集、安裝文件和配置文件等
/etc/rc.d/init.d/ 啟動(dòng)腳本文件的 mysql 目錄,可以用來啟動(dòng)和停止 MySQL 服務(wù) 

步驟 7):配置 MySQL 服務(wù),將 /usr/share/mysql/ 或 /usr/share/ 文件夾下的某一個(gè)后綴名為 cnf 的文件拷貝到 /etc/ 文件夾下,并且改名為 my.cnf。使用 vi 編輯器來編輯 my.cnf(我們在《 my.cnf配置文件詳解》一節(jié)介紹了 my.cnf 配置文件中各參數(shù)的具體意義)。命令如下:

cp /usr/share/mysql/my-large.cnf /etc/my.cnf
vi /etc/my.cnf

第一行命令可以完成復(fù)制和改名的工作,第二行命令可以編輯 my.cnf。

注意:使用 vi 進(jìn)入 my.cnf 文件后,按 i 或 a 鍵進(jìn)行編輯。按 Esc 鍵就可以退出編輯狀態(tài),轉(zhuǎn)為進(jìn)入命令狀態(tài)。如果要保存修改的數(shù)據(jù),輸入
:w即可,如果不希望保存而直接退出,輸入
:q!即可。

編輯并保存 my.cnf 文件后,必須重新啟動(dòng) MySQL 服務(wù),這樣 my.cnf 中的配置才會(huì)起作用。


網(wǎng)頁標(biāo)題:創(chuàng)新互聯(lián)數(shù)據(jù)庫教程:Linux安裝配置MySQL詳細(xì)步驟
本文地址:http://www.dlmjj.cn/article/dhecsed.html